Republic of Cyprus | Appointment of special envoy from the UN gets green light

President Christodoulidis states he is determined and ready for decisions that will lead to the reunification of the Motherland.

The Republic of Cyprus gave its consent late on Saturday for the appointment of a special envoy from the United Nations, who will look into the prospect of resuming talks, in response to a request by the UN Secretary-General.

The President of the Republic, Nikos Christodoulidis, stated the above the day before yesterday in his speech in Astromeritis, in the context of the anti-occupation events of the Municipality of Morphou “Days in Memory of Morphou”.

Such a development, the appointment of an envoy who will focus on the prospect of resuming talks, will be an initial development in the right direction which may lead to more general positive developments for all parties involved in the Cyprus issue if the appropriate political will is expressed, he continued.
